** The Volvo repair market specifically in Corry, PA is limited, with no dedicated Volvo specialists operating within the city. Residents seeking routine maintenance may use local general mechanics, but for the specialized services required for modern Volvos—especially concerning AWD, complex electronics (Sensus), hybrid systems, and safety calibrations—they must travel to the Erie metropolitan area, approximately a 30-minute drive. The market in Erie is robust and competitive for European auto service. The quality is generally high, with several shops, like the ones listed, possessing the specific tools, software, and technician training required to service Volvos properly. These specialists compete directly with the franchised Volvo dealer in Erie, often providing comparable or superior expertise at a more competitive labor rate. Typical pricing for specialized Volvo repair in this region ranges from $125-$175 per hour for labor. The presence of multiple high-quality independent shops indicates a healthy, competitive environment that benefits Volvo owners in the broader Northwestern Pennsylvania region, including Corry.
